What Are uPVC Doors and Windows?
uPVC, or Unplasticized Polyvinyl Chloride, is a kind of polymer that has actually revolutionized the building and home enhancement market. Unlike standard PVC, uPVC is rigid, resilient, and ecologically friendly, as it does not consist of plasticizers. When utilized in the manufacture of doors and windows, door window replacement uPVC frames are combined with glass or other materials, leading to tough, weather-resistant, and energy-efficient installations.
Over the past couple of years, uPVC windows and doors have become perfect replacements for conventional wood or metal equivalents due to their remarkable performance and low upkeep demands.
Advantages of uPVC Doors and Windows
Remarkable Durability uPVC is extremely resistant to rotting, rusting, and rust, making it one of the most resilient materials for doors and windows. It can withstand extreme weather condition conditions, including heavy rain, strong winds, and intense sunshine, without warping or fading with time.

Energy Efficiency Modern homes are increasingly developed with energy performance in mind, and uPVC doors and windows fit the costs completely. Their superior insulation homes help in maintaining indoor temperatures, lowering the requirement for extreme heating or cooling. This translates to lower energy expenses and a smaller sized carbon footprint.
Sound Insulation Urban living typically comes with its fair share of sound pollution. uPVC windows and doors offer excellent soundproofing, making sure a quieter and more serene home.

Numerous models integrate multi-point locking mechanisms, toughened glass, and steel reinforcements, making them a reputable option for home security.
Trendy and Customizable Available in a large range of colors, finishes, and styles, uPVC doors and windows can effortlessly blend into any architectural design. Whether you prefer a modern-day appearance or a more standard feel, there are endless alternatives to suit your preferences.
Environmentally Friendly The production process of uPVC produces less waste compared to other products, and the frames are recyclable at the end of their lifecycle. This makes them an environmentally friendly option for environmentally mindful homeowners.
Cost-efficient Although the initial financial investment might be a little greater than some traditional materials, the long-term cost savings in energy, maintenance, and replacement costs make uPVC windows and doors a wise monetary option.

Setup Process and Considerations
Setting up uPVC doors and windows is an uncomplicated process when done by professionals. Nevertheless, specific aspects need to be considered:
Precise Measurements: Proper sizing guarantees a snug fit and lessens the danger of air leaks.
Quality Glass Material: Double or triple glazing is advised for enhanced insulation and security.
Professional Installation: Always rely on experienced specialists to ensure that the frames are safely set up and sealed.
